There was a problem hiding this comment.
Why did the numInvocations change? 🤔
There was a problem hiding this comment.
Good call! Investigated more, and I think it's because of a bug in wireit, that this test was testing, and that this change fixes. The relevant change is that I made services care about whether their dependencies are fully tracked when deciding whether they need to restart. If a dependency ran, and it's not cascade: false, and it's not fully tracked, then the service must restart, because the service's boot up might depend on an untracked output of the dependency.
In more detail:
[standard] wasn't cacheable (i.e. wasn't fully tracked) as originally written because it didn't have an output field. As a result, when we write 3 to standard's input file again, it needs to run again, and because of that [service] needs to restart, because [service] might consume some output of [standard] th was emitted differently this time.
However this test is trying to test cases where [service] doesn't need to restart, i.e. when after a failure of [standard] we can revert it back to its previous version. That requires that [standard] have an output field, and then its final run is just a restore from cache.
